25 lines
545 B
Go
25 lines
545 B
Go
package dtos
|
|
|
|
type IndexViewData struct {
|
|
User *CurrentUser
|
|
Settings map[string]interface{}
|
|
AppUrl string
|
|
AppSubUrl string
|
|
GoogleAnalyticsId string
|
|
GoogleTagManagerId string
|
|
MainNavLinks []*NavLink
|
|
}
|
|
|
|
type PluginCss struct {
|
|
Light string `json:"light"`
|
|
Dark string `json:"dark"`
|
|
}
|
|
|
|
type NavLink struct {
|
|
Text string `json:"text"`
|
|
Icon string `json:"icon"`
|
|
Img string `json:"img"`
|
|
Url string `json:"url"`
|
|
Children []*NavLink `json:"children"`
|
|
}
|